**** Rakesh Kumar Jain, J. (Oral) This petition is filed for the issuance of a writ in the nature of certiorari for quashing the order dated 30.09.2014 passed by the Commissioner, Gurugram, exercising his powers under Section 42 of the East Punjab Holdings (Consolidation and Prevention of Fragmentation) Act, 1948 and the order dated 13.07.2015 passed by the Consolidation Officer-cumTehsildar, Narnaul. During the course of hearing, counsel for the petitioner has admitted that aggrieved against the aforesaid orders, one Inder Kumar had served legal notice-cum-representation dated 16.12.2015 and contempt notice dated 20.08.2016 upon the official respondents and when no action was taken upon his legal notice-cum-representation and contempt notice, he filed CWP No.5445 of 2017, which was disposed of by this Court on 17.03.

2017 with the following order:- "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that he will be satisfied if direction is issued to respondent no.2 for taking appropriate action on the legal notice-cum-representation dated VINOD KUMAR 2019.04.

CWP No.7709 of 2019 [ 2 ] 16.12.2015 (Annexure P-5) and contempt notice dated 20.08.2016 (Annexure P-6) within a stipulated period.

Without going into the merits and demerits of the matter, I direct respondent No.2 to consider the legal notice-cumrepresentation dated 16.12.2015 (Annexure P-5) and contempt notice dated 20.08.2016 (Annexure P-6) served upon him by the petitioner and pass a speaking order thereon, in accordance with law within a period of two months from the date of receipt of certified copy of this order.

The writ petition stands dispose of with the above direction. It is, however, submitted by the counsel for the petitioner that despite the directions issued by this Court to pass a speaking order within a period of two months upon the legal notice-cum-representation dated 16.12.2015 and contempt notice dated 20.08.2016, nothing has been done by the official respondents till date.

Now the factual position emerges out of the peculiar facts of this case is that the petitioner is basically aggrieved against the inaction on the part of the official respondents in not passing speaking order on the legal noticecum-representation dated 16.12.2015 and contempt notice dated 20.08.2016, against which the petitioner has an appropriate remedy to approach the concerned authorities or the contempt Court.

In view of the above, the present writ petition is dismissed being not maintainable in the present form.
